# PyApple MCP Tools

[![Python](https://img.shields.io/badge/python-3.10+-blue.svg)](https://www.python.org/downloads/)
[![License](https://img.shields.io/badge/license-MIT-green.svg)](LICENSE)
[![MCP](https://img.shields.io/badge/MCP-compatible-purple.svg)](https://modelcontextprotocol.io)

A Python implementation of Apple-native tools for the [Model Context Protocol (MCP)](https://modelcontextprotocol.com/docs/mcp-protocol), providing seamless integration with macOS applications.

## Features

- **Messages**: Send and read messages using the Apple Messages app
- **Notes**: List, search, create, and delete notes in Apple Notes app  
- **Contacts**: Search contacts from Apple Contacts
- **Emails**: Send emails, search messages, and manage mail with Apple Mail
- **Reminders**: List, search, and create reminders in Apple Reminders app
- **Calendar**: Search events, create calendar entries, and manage your schedule
- **Web Search**: Search the web using DuckDuckGo
- **Maps**: Search locations, get directions, and manage guides with Apple Maps

## Quick Installation

### Automated Setup (Recommended)

```bash
# Install pyapple-mcp
pip install pyapple-mcp

# Run the setup helper to configure Claude Desktop
pyapple-mcp-setup
```

The setup helper will:
- Find your pyapple-mcp installation
- Locate your Claude Desktop config file
- Automatically add the configuration
- Display helpful setup information

### Manual Installation

1. **Install pyapple-mcp**:
   ```bash
   pip install pyapple-mcp
   ```

2. **Configure Claude Desktop** by editing `~/Library/Application Support/Claude Desktop/claude_desktop_config.json`:
   ```json
   {
     "mcpServers": {
       "pyapple": {
         "command": "pyapple-mcp"
       }
     }
   }
   ```

3. **Restart Claude Desktop** to load the new configuration.

## Requirements

- **macOS 10.15+** (Catalina or later)
- **Python 3.10+**
- **Appropriate permissions** for accessing:
  - Contacts
  - Calendar
  - Messages
  - Mail
  - Notes
  - Reminders
  - Automation (for controlling apps)

## Permissions Setup

On first use, macOS will prompt for various permissions. Grant access to:

1. **Contacts** - for contact search functionality
2. **Calendar** - for calendar event management
3. **Messages** - for sending/reading messages  
4. **Mail** - for email operations
5. **Notes** - for notes access
6. **Reminders** - for reminder management
7. **Automation** - for controlling applications via AppleScript

## Troubleshooting

### Common Issues

**Permission Denied Errors**:
- Go to **System Settings > Privacy & Security**
- Grant access to the required applications
- Restart Claude Desktop

**Module Import Errors**:
- Ensure you're running on macOS
- Install PyObjC frameworks: `pip install pyobjc`

**AppleScript Execution Errors**:
- Check that the target applications are installed
- Verify automation permissions in System Settings

**Setup Issues**:
- Run `pyapple-mcp-setup --help` for setup options
- Check that pyapple-mcp is in your PATH: `which pyapple-mcp`
- Use `pyapple-mcp-setup --config-path /path/to/config` for custom config locations

### Debug Mode

Run with debug logging:
```bash
PYAPPLE_DEBUG=1 python -m pyapple_mcp.server
```
